What is the effect of increased deforestation on Earth's atmosphere? 🔊
Increased deforestation significantly affects Earth's atmosphere by raising levels of carbon dioxide. Trees play a vital role in absorbing CO2 for photosynthesis; their removal reduces this absorption capacity, contributing to a greenhouse effect. Consequently, this can accelerate global warming, disrupt weather patterns, and lead to habitat loss for numerous species, exacerbating biodiversity loss.
